A utility jacket is undeniably one of those basic wardrobe pieces and a favourite of the style soldiers and is also a great staple piece for fall.With the slight dip in temperatures now you can get your jackets and blazers out.
If camouflage prints are not your way then you can sport the military trend with a olive/army green jacket.
With this army green jacket you can go classic or be fashion forward. Whether in trend or not this particular style never goes out of fashion.

I added this light weight military jacket to my closet last fall.As you can see there is nothing feminine about the jacket like some jackets which are embellished ...etc.Hence to soften up the look and make it more feminine I paired it with skinny denims.I personally think such utility jackets were made to give you an immensely casual and comfortable look.Nothing much needs to be done the jacket does everything for the outfit.

Its a perfect layering piece for fall.If you are looking for sporting cammo/military trend you can even try cammo printed shirts.I have off lately spotted many cammo printed shirts in sheer,embellished,with spikes.

  Chambray.where should I start with chambray.Chambray shirts are so low maintenance and versatile , can be worn as a layering piece to add texture and dimension to your outfit or worn by themselves.Paired with neutral pants ,knotted over a dress,tucked into a pleated or flowy skirt or just with other denims it just gels in effortlessly.

 Many people confuse chambray with denim but they are two different things and fundamentally very much different.Chambray is very much lighter then denim whereas as denim is coarse material.
